Output e84a4b5960d8f4f6c12e7330c8ba8c268f9db6dbef00c1741f6ecb5a81d492f7:0

value
133000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 320a757bdf7fa385c490b3f82ebac13920465afe OP_EQUAL
address
36FcEqKQRnYb5KfhvwtvJ4jayzH3EbeofC
transaction
e84a4b5960d8f4f6c12e7330c8ba8c268f9db6dbef00c1741f6ecb5a81d492f7
confirmations
11332
spent
true